Green light for 1,400 homes in South West Aylesbury

shutterstock_2475997497

Buckinghamshire Council agrees section 106 on Gleeson Land’s proposed development

Plans to build 1,400 homes in South West Aylesbury have been approved by Buckinghamshire Council.

Proposals brought forward by Nexus Planning, on behalf of land promoter Gleeson Land and three local landowners, were initially discussed by the council’s planning committee at the end of March.
